    Inverter battery self-discharge current

    There are two main components in a battery storage system: the battery inverter / charger, and the battery itself. These are often packaged together in one cabinet. The battery inverter is only required for AC co. There are several key parameters that need to be considered in comparing different batteries: 1. Nominal capacity (Ah) and discharge current (A); 2. Nominal capacity (kWh); 3. Battery capacity shows how much energy the battery can nominally deliver from fully charged, under a certain set of discharge conditions. The most relevant conditions aredischarge cur. Electricity usage is billed in kWh. 1 kWh is the the electricity consumed by running a continuous load of 1000W for one hour. The output of a solar system is also measured in kWh. It is there. The power output of the battery in Watts is given by So if our 500Ah battery has an operating current of 20A and an operating voltage of 12V, then it has a power rating of 240W. When sizi.

    Vienna lithium battery winding

    After slitting the cathode roll, separator and anode roll, the winding process is to winding them by a fixed winding needle in sequence and extruding them into a cylindrical or square shape, then placing them inside a square or cylindrical metal shell. The size of the slitted rolls, the number of coils and other. The stacking process is to cut the cathode and anode sheets into the required size, then stack the cathode sheets, separator and anode sheets into small cell unit, and then stack the small cell. Pouch cell: Two technology are both adopted, it depends on the cell manufacturer. Blade cell: Designed and produced by stacking process. Prismatic cell: Both stacking and.
